Drivers concerned about tight pit entry at Baku

Formula 1 drivers have expressed concerns about the challenge provided by the pit entry at the Baku circuit. Cars will have to peel off the high-speed straight into a tight chicane, which is followed by another 100 metres of straight pit lane before the speed limit begins at the pit entry white line. The chicane is thus in effect part of the track, and in race conditions will have to be taken as fast as possible. Sauber's Marcus Ericsson was one of the most outspoken, as he believes the entry could lead to 'big accidents'. "The entry looks a bit interesting," said Ericsson.
